Output 31d3dc507bb87be566c8b7e1bf76be189d2e42734bf2d41df070af71f6c08cdc:1

value
743184
script pubkey
OP_0 OP_PUSHBYTES_20 8b22409aadcbe36d958e93f5c334bcdac91eb73d
address
bc1q3v3ypx4de03km9vwj06uxd9umty3adeacx5l66
transaction
31d3dc507bb87be566c8b7e1bf76be189d2e42734bf2d41df070af71f6c08cdc
confirmations
65378
spent
true